Open Restaurant Q&A with DOT

With Phase 2 now in effect for NYC, the City of New York has launched the Open Restaurants program, which allows restaurants and bars to expand via a self-certification process to outdoor seating on qualifying sidewalks, curb lanes, backyards, patios, plazas, and Open Streets. Open Streets: Restaurants Q&A with DOT

The Open Streets: Restaurants program is expanding weekend seating options for restaurants on select corridors citywide by temporarily closing streets to traffic to create outdoor dining space. Community-based organizations, BIDs and small groups of restaurants applying through a single entity may apply.
